
Roxana Illuminated Perfumes
Botanical perfumery made from pure plant materials.
Roxana Illuminated Perfumes is a California-based natural fragrance house founded in 2007 by Roxana Villa, who approaches perfumery as a botanical art practice rooted in the Western herbalism tradition. Villa works exclusively with plant-derived materials—essential oils, absolutes, CO2 extracts, and resins—rejecting synthetic aromachemicals in favor of materials that carry the biological complexity of their source plants. Each release is handcrafted in small quantities and often packaged with an emphasis on visual and sensory beauty that treats the bottle as an art object. The house is active in the natural perfumery community and Villa has contributed to education in that field. Notable releases include Alba, Flora Carnivora, and Tango, which demonstrate her range from delicate to intensely resinous compositions. Roxana Illuminated Perfumes occupies the niche tier and is sold primarily through the house's own website and a small number of curated natural beauty retailers.
